The kkStB 51 series of steam locomotives was a series of freight trains with a tender from the kkStB , which originally came from the KFNB .

The KFNB put a total of 120 of this series of locomotives into service. They were supplied by the StEG Lokomotivfabrik , Wiener Neustädter Lokomotivfabrik and Lokomotivfabrik Floridsdorf from 1871 to 1889 and differed in details due to this long delivery period. The data in the table are therefore only typical values ​​for the last deliveries. The tenders used also varied.

The KFNB gave them the series designation Vd and the numbers 391-510 . In addition, all of the machines were given names ranging alphabetically from "ALTENMARKT" to "ZATOR".

All machines came to the kkStB and formed the 51 series there .

After the First World War , some of the series 51 came to the CFR , to the PKP as series Th 16 to ČSD as series 312.1 and 313.0 and to the BBÖ . The PKP decommissioned the locomotives until 1925, the BBÖ until 1932 . The ČSD operated these machines until 1963.

The series designation 51 was already occupied by the kkStB. The 51.01–03 was redrawn in 1892 as 50 .26–28, the 51.04–12 at the same time as 54 .41–49.
